I Spy DIY pure lovers 5 inch and up Loca por los tacones Sock Bun Tutorial in 5 Easy Steps! I am not a hair person. Meaning, I can barely do my own hair in a ponytail. I also have very fine hair, so the topknots just point out the super fine strands. Lately, I’ve been seeing these hair donuts around, wondering what they could be used for, and after going to London, and having flat iron issues, I just said to heck with it and took a chance on the hair donut, and see if it a simpleton such as myself could figure it out. Low and behold, even with no instructions, figuring out the sock bun was super easy, and it took only a few seconds! You’ll need: One hair donut, two hair bands, a comb or brush, and some bobby pins. Put your hair in a ponytail Thread your ponytail through the hair donut Smooth your hair over the hair donut, distributing your hair evenly Put a second hair band over the hair donut Pin the extra hair around the bun And you’re done!
